STUDENT VISA TO CANADA

STUDENT VISA TO CANADA

Canada is proud to welcome students from all over the world. Every year, Canada welcomes more than 130,000 foreign students to its world-class Universities and Colleges. Foreign students are attracted to Canada because of its high-quality education system, state of the art research facilities, and broad post-graduate employment opportunities.

Tuition costs in Canada remain affordable. In fact, Canada has the lowest tuition rates among New Zealand, Australian, UK and American universities.

ACADEMIC STUDENT VISA BASIC REQUIREMENTS

The Canadian Student Visa allows foreign students to take advantage of Canada's world-class education system. If you wish to study in Canada for 6 months or more, you will generally need to apply for a Student Visa.

The specific requirements for the Student Visa will vary depending on your level of study, your educational background, and your country of citizenship. Generally, you will need acceptance to a university, college or other recognized academic institution in Canada, a valid passport or travel document, proof of financial support which shows that you can support yourself (and any accompanying dependants) while you are studying in Canada.

ACADEMIC STUDENT VISA ENTITLEMENTS

Foreign Students in Canada are not limited to life in a classroom. All students are encouraged to take advantage of the employment opportunities that can be earned with a Canadian post-secondary education. Foreign Students are often entitled to apply for scholarship to Canadian universities and colleges. Many educational institutions offer awards, scholarships, and bursaries to international students on a competitive basis. Information on financial awards can be obtained directly from the institution itself.

Foreign students are eligible to work on-campus throughout the school year. This allows students to earn money towards tuition, explore Canada, and gain valuable Canadian work experience. Once a foreign student has lived in Canada for at least 6 months, most are eligible to apply for employment off-campus. This will allow students to work up to 20 hours a week off-campus during the school year and full-time during school holidays.

In most cases, foreign students are entitled to apply for a Post-Graduation Work Permit, once they complete their course of study. The Post-Graduation Work Permit enables graduates to remain in Canada and gain full time work experience for up to two years in some cases.

While in Canada on a work Visa, it may also be possible to extend your stay and have your permanent residence application processed in tandem, which could allow you to stay in Canada once your application has been approved.
